2013-02-27 6 views
0

Я создаю приложение для Android, которое поддерживает VoIP/IM/Presence с доступным стеклом SIP для Android. Мне также необходимо развернуть SIP-сервер, чтобы включить упомянутые функции SIP как часть моего проекта.Какой сервер SIP для развертывания для Android-приложения Android?

Разработка приложения для Android кажется простым со всеми доступными ресурсами и изобилующими исходными текстами онлайн. Тем не менее, я серьезно застрял в развертывании SIP-сервера для связи с приложением.

Я экспериментировал в течение месяца с OpenSIPS, но он казался немного продвинутым до моего уровня. Особенно, что он работает в среде linux.

  1. Любые предложения для других простых в развертывании и простых в использовании SIP-серверов?

  2. Я еще не провел подробных исследований по этому вопросу, но что вы думаете о Microsoft Lync Server для этой цели?

+0

[Звездочка] (http://www.asterisk.org/) может быть? –

+0

@ Жасмин ... У меня такая же проблема. Пожалуйста, предложите мне в простой форме, как вы это решили. Мне нужно реализовать SIP с VOIP с устройствами iOS. Заранее спасибо. –

+0

@singhSan Мне очень жаль моего позднего ответа, я просто должен был увидеть ваш комментарий. Я использовал TrixBox (реализация Asterisk). Он устанавливается со всеми необходимыми конфигурациями, и все, что вам нужно сделать, это добавить свои расширения (пользователей) в систему, чтобы запустить его и запустить из веб-интерфейса. Надеюсь, мой ответ поможет. – Jasmine91

ответ

0

Как предложил Ктулу в комментариях, я предлагаю опробовать Asterisk. Только несколько файлов (sip.conf и extensions.conf IIRC) должны быть настроены для его прослушивания и прослушивания.

Существует также отличная бесплатная книга, которая поможет с терминологией и настройкой, когда только начинается. Книга читается полностью online. Вы также можете скачать PDF version from O'Reilly.

Есть также много разновидностей Asterisk, которые имеют несколько упрощенные интерфейсы, чтобы упростить настройку в первый раз. AsteriskNow можно скачать прямо с Digium (компания, ответственная за проект Asterisk). Если вы собираетесь делать больше работы SIP в будущем, возможно, стоит использовать «настоящую» Asterisk, но если это одно время, попробуйте AsteriskNow.

Другим основным проектом для исследования будет Freeswitch, хотя я считаю, что установка Asterisk будет немного более простой.

+0

Спасибо за ответ! До сих пор я искал Asterisk, и я нашел много проектов на его основе. Я не уверен, следует ли выбирать OpenFire, TrixBox или AsteriskNOW. Я действительно ищу простую в установке программу с большим сообществом поддержки, так что это не займет много времени, и я смогу больше сосредоточиться на приложении :) – Jasmine91

+0

Hi Jasmine. К сожалению, у меня нет большого опыта работы с дистрибутивами Asterisk. Однако быстрый поиск привел меня в Amatix Instant PBX: http://amatisoft.com/egroupware/sitemgr/sitemgr-site/?page_name=AmatixInstantPBX Запишите ISO на компакт-диск, а затем загрузите свой компьютер с него, чтобы включить его в поле Asterisk. Многие другие загрузочные версии Asterisk здесь: http://www.voip-info.org/wiki/view/Asterisk+Bootable+CDROM –

+0

Спасибо Dan! Извините за задержку с ответом. Я использовал TrixBox, и он отлично работает. – Jasmine91

Смежные вопросы